Swing Vs. Sliding Automated Gates: Pros & Cons

Automated gates are an excellent investment for homeowners and businesses, providing security, convenience, and a touch of sophistication. When selecting a gate automation system, one of the key decisions is choosing between swing and sliding gates. Each option has distinct advantages and drawbacks, making it important to consider factors such as space, budget, and maintenance needs before making a decision. Keep reading to learn the benefits and drawbacks of each option to make an informed decision.

Swing Gates: Pros & Cons

Swing gates operate much like a standard door, opening either inward or outward on hinges. They are commonly used in residential settings due to their classic appearance.

Pros:

• Aesthetic Appeal – Swing gates offer a traditional and elegant look, making them a popular choice for homes with decorative fencing.

• Lower Maintenance – With fewer mechanical components compared to sliding gates, they generally require less maintenance.

• Quieter Operation – Swing gates operate with minimal noise, unlike sliding gates that rely on rollers and tracks.

• Cost-Effective ...
... Installation – The installation process is often simpler and more affordable than sliding gates since they do not require a track system.

Cons:

• Space Requirements – Swing gates need sufficient clearance to open fully, making them impractical for properties with limited driveway space.

• Wind Resistance – In high-wind areas, swing gates can be more susceptible to force, potentially causing operational issues.

• Not Suitable for Slopes – Swing gates do not function well on sloped driveways, as they require a level surface to operate properly.

Sliding Gates: Pros & Cons

Sliding gates move horizontally along a track, making them ideal for properties where space is limited or where added security is required.

Pros:

• Space-Saving – Unlike swing gates, sliding gates require minimal clearance and can be installed in narrow driveways.

• Enhanced Security – Sliding gates are more difficult to force open, making them a stronger deterrent against intruders.

• Ideal for Sloped Driveways – Since they move sideways rather than swinging, sliding gates work well on uneven terrain.

• Weather Resistant – Sliding gates are more resistant to wind and external pressure, ensuring reliability in harsh weather conditions.


Cons:

• Higher Installation Costs – Sliding gates require a track and motor system, which increases the initial installation expenses.

• Regular Maintenance Required – The track must be kept clear of debris, dirt, and leaves to prevent the gate from jamming.

• More Moving Parts – With rollers, motors, and a guide track, sliding gates have more components that may require servicing over time.

Which Gate Type is Right for You?

The choice between swing and sliding gates in Perth depends on several factors:


• Available Space – If you have a wide, open entrance, swing gates can be a great option. However, if space is limited, sliding gates are more practical.

• Security Concerns – Sliding gates provide superior protection due to their robust locking mechanism, making them ideal for high-security areas.

• Budget Considerations – While swing gates typically have a lower upfront cost, sliding gates may offer better long-term value due to their durability and security benefits.

• Maintenance Preferences – Swing gates require less maintenance, whereas sliding gates need regular track cleaning and servicing.
